Autonomous runs

An autonomous run is the core of Marvin. You provide a research question or topic, and Marvin handles the rest — searching relevant literature, forming hypotheses, designing and running analyses, and delivering structured findings you can act on.

You start a run from the Start Marvin control. Before it begins, you set three things:

  • Length. Choose a specific number of iterations, or select Until STOP to let Marvin decide for itself when the research is complete.
  • Compute. Specify the resources Marvin may use — CPU cores and which GPU types to allow.
  • Budget. Set a spend cap for the run. Marvin will not exceed it.

Once a run is going, you can step away. Watch it live in the UI, or come back later — everything is saved. You can stop a run at any time if you want to cut it short.

Persistent memory

Marvin remembers what it learns. Findings, literature, and the decisions behind them are preserved across your projects and across every run.

This means your research builds on itself rather than starting over each time. When Marvin returns to a topic you've explored before, it brings that prior context to the new work.

You can review the results of any past run at any point — nothing is discarded.

Research findings

A finding is a structured result that comes out of a run. Each finding is made up of four parts:

  • The conclusion — what was found.
  • The evidence — the data, metrics, and literature behind it.
  • A confidence level — how strongly the evidence supports the conclusion, expressed in plain language: established, suggested, speculative, inconclusive, or refuted.
  • What it means — the interpretation, in context.

Findings are organized by project and by run, so you can trace any result back to where it came from. You can review them in-app and copy their contents to share or cite.

Project management

Projects organize your research by topic or goal. Every project has a mission and a set of specific goals that keep the work focused.

Within a project, runs produce iterations, and iterations produce findings — a clean hierarchy that lets you see how your understanding developed over time.

The Time Machine lets you navigate that history. Step forward and back through any past run or iteration and review it on its own, independent of the others. It's a full timeline of your project's thinking.

Integrations

Marvin connects to academic literature databases out of the box, including arXiv, Semantic Scholar, PubMed, and more — so it can pull in relevant papers without any setup from you.

Cloud compute — CPU and GPU — is provisioned automatically for each run, based on the resources you allow.

Connecting your own data sources is coming soon. It's on the roadmap, but not available in the current release.

Billing and plans

Marvin uses a two-part billing model. Your plan includes a monthly allowance of research capacity, and on top of that you have a wallet of top-up credits for when you need more.

Your current usage appears as a percentage bar in the sidebar, so you can see at a glance how much of your allowance you've used.

The Free tier gives you chat and literature lookup only — autonomous runs require a paid plan. Paid plans are Academic, Pro, Team, and Enterprise. The Enterprise plan supports BYOK (bring your own keys).
